Transaction 07d5a261d261446fe911b37c7b4f06520831574f49d3de960b8fc4bcf46c7e77

3 Input
1 Outputs
  • 07d5a261d261446fe911b37c7b4f06520831574f49d3de960b8fc4bcf46c7e77:0
  • value  3399000
    address  3CTSXnKUGnFRBSWENjVrBsjNaEF3HAiuZm